Springfield Armory 1911-A1 Loaded .45 ACP, Stainless, Full-Size, 5 inch Barrel
This Springfield Armory 1911-A1 Loaded is a full-size, stainless .45 ACP with a Government-length 5 inch bushing-fitted barrel and classic single-stack 7+1 capacity. It features hallmark Loaded-series upgrades, including front and rear cocking serrations, an extended beavertail grip safety, and a long, lightened trigger. The pistol carries the FI BRAZIL marking indicating IMBEL manufacture for Springfield, with the legacy Model 1911-A1 rollmark and crossed-cannons crest.

The Loaded configuration brings practical enhancements to the classic 1911 format. This pistol includes front and rear cocking serrations for positive manipulation and a lowered, flared ejection port to aid reliable case clearance.
Controls and internals reflect a tuned carry-and-range mindset: a thumb safety and an extended beavertail grip safety, paired with a long, lightened three-hole trigger and a commander-style skeletonized hammer.
The slide and frame wear a stainless matte/brushed finish. Sights are fixed, with a blade front and a dovetailed rear notch. The installed black wraparound rubber grips add finger grooves and a pebble texture for a secure hold.
Manufacture markings include "SPRINGFIELD GENESEO IL USA" and "FI BRAZIL," the latter indicating IMBEL production for Springfield. Forged components are standard on Springfield 1911 production lines, aligning with the pistol's robust construction and legacy 1911-A1 rollmark with the crossed-cannons crest.
